Serpentine Tumbled Stones: Mineral Profile and Spiritual Associations
Serpentine is not a single mineral but a group of magnesium silicate minerals sharing a characteristic layered structure and snake-like visual patterning that gives the group its name. The primary varieties encountered in metaphysical trade include antigorite, lizardite, and chrysotile, all forming in metamorphic and ultramafic rocks across Italy, New Zealand, China, Russia, and the United States. Serpentine has been carved and used for amulets, tools, and ceremonial objects since antiquity in cultures from ancient Egypt to Mesoamerica, drawn by its distinctive green color and smooth, almost waxy surface. Where does serpentine come from?
Serpentine is a magnesium silicate mineral group that forms in metamorphic rocks worldwide, with notable deposits in Italy, China, New Zealand, and the United States. Its green color and wavy patterning give it its snake-inspired name in mineralogy.
